Why a rough terrain crane is essential for challenging job sites
Construction and industrial projects don’t always take place on smooth, paved surfaces. In many cases, work must be carried out on uneven terrain such as mud, gravel, or remote job sites where stability becomes a major challenge. This is where a mobile crane Vancouver solution proves highly valuable. Designed to handle demanding environments, these cranes deliver strength, balance, and flexibility while ensuring safe and efficient lifting operations even in the toughest conditions. Unlike traditional cranes that require stable ground, rough terrain cranes—often included in a mobile crane Vancouver fleet are built with large rubber tires and a robust wheeled system. This allows them to move easily across uneven surfaces without compromising performance. They are commonly used in construction zones, oil and gas sites, infrastructure developments, and industrial facilities where standard cranes may struggle.
